FR- Tastes
Ate here on a Saturday night of the Australia Day long weekend, the restaurant was packed but have been greeted and treated promptly with the staff’s 5 star hospitality. They had the Jollibee specials this week; and we just had to try their Palabok, thin Palabok noodles served with a generous amount of sauce enriched with baby prawns and finally topped off with boiled egg, spring onion and really crunchy pork crackling. We also tried the burger steak, definitely felt nostalgic with this one! The burger was cooked juicy and that mushroom gravy definitely brings you back to jollibee days for sure! Another highlight dish of the night is the pork Bagnet, no wonder this one was on their “Bestseller” list!! It was cooked to perfection! Generous amount of salt and spices with precise cooking methods has clearly been executed to present an absolute winner of a dish. Was aesthetically served hot, super crispy and cut in to bite-sized pieces which made it a lot easier to indulge on. The sauce took this dish from a winner to a champion! The sweet and sour-ness of the dipping sauce had you eating more and talking less. <br/>And finally for dessert, we had Halo Halo Espesyal, super colourful, tasty and had your tastebuds dancing with the complexities of the textures and tastes this dessert had. From the crunchy toasted rice flakes to the soft gooey jackfruit,mung beans, sugared bananas and yams, the bouncy bites of coconut gel and tapioca pearls.. to the ultra creamy Leche flan and Milk; down to the fine powdery textured shaved ice.... it’s like a party on your mouth and EVERYONE is invited! <br/>The food was superb, the ambience was very warm and welcoming and the staff is definitely something to be commended for. Fast, attentive, effective, always smiling and pleasant and most importantly got things done. <br/><br/>Location: was a bit far, but had ample parking space and quite accessible.<br/><br/>Price: was on point, with generous portion sizes.<br/><br/>It was a great experience, and would definitely dine here again.
